我在我的Java文件中用英文写了评论,但现在我的客户想要用西班牙语,所以在RAD或ECLIPSE IDE中是否有任何工具/插件可用于转换其他语言的所有评论。我正在使用谷歌翻译手动转换评论。
答案 0 :(得分:2)
我不知道有这样的插件。首先,我会确保客户真的想要这个。对高技术文本进行自动翻译不会提供非常好的质量。我怀疑它们是否可以使用,先做几个评论的测试翻译以获得批准。
如果他们真的想要一些有用的东西,那么有语言和技术技能的人就必须手动翻译所有东西,这需要时间/金钱。
但是,如果我不得不这样做,我会从this answer接受这个想法,自动从Eclipse启动一个Web浏览器,并使用URL进行谷歌翻译,https://translate.google.se/#en/es/${selected_text}
,应该可行。
如果代码库很大并且可以轻松找到注释,例如javadoc,我会编写一些脚本来自动处理这个问题。 Google翻译有一个可以使用的API。见REST API doc
答案 1 :(得分:1)
每时每刻,开发人员都必须使用他不知道的语言编写代码。在这种情况下,他需要将变量,类,方法名称复制到Google Translate上,以查看其实际含义。
当将鼠标悬停在Eclipse上时,Eclipse中的Source Code Translation会通过提供带有已翻译单词的弹出窗口来尝试帮助此类开发人员。该插件可以处理使用camelCase或下划线“ _”作为分隔方法的复合词或短语。
要使插件正常工作,需要包含要翻译的单词的属性文件,并且需要在插件的“首选项”部分中创建并添加翻译。
将此URL添加到Eclipse安装中以访问此解决方案的更新站点。
https://github.com/Testehan/TranslationPluginInstall/raw/master
答案 2 :(得分:0)
在外部工具配置中
地点:${system_path:cmd.exe}
参数:/C start "" "https://translate.google.com/#en/fr/${selected_text}"